For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 549 students in Hamtramck Academy School District. This district's average test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public schools in Michigan.
Public School in Hamtramck Academy School District have an average math proficiency score of 48% (versus the Michigan public school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 46%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 87% of the student body (majority Asian), which is more than the Michigan public school average of 37% (majority Black).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$10,623 in this school district is less than the state median of $18,604.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$10,432 is less than the state median of $17,782.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
